comparemela.com

Top Locations Tagged with Minds Miracle

Minds Miracle in India - 110026/Local-business near West Delhi

1). Miracle Minds Pre School Delhi India

Minds Miracle in India - 382721/Education near Gandhi Nagar

2). Mind S Miracle Ahmedabad India

Minds Miracle in India - 382725/School near kalol/School near Panchmahal

3). Mind's Miracle Kidszone

Minds Miracle in India - 388001/School near Anand

4). Mind's Miracle

Minds Miracle in United States - 38106/Child-care near Shelby

5). Miracle Minds Learning Academy School, Gleason Ave

vimarsana © 2020. All Rights Reserved.